The Buhari administration has normalized Southeast injustice and hypocrisy – IPOB lawyer

Ifeanyi Ejiofor, legal counselor to Nnamdi Kanu, the head of the Native Nation of Biafra (IPOB), has censured the Mohammadu Buhari-drove Central Government for the IPOB pioneer’s proceeded with detainment.
Ejiofor slammed the Federal Government of Nigeria for enforcing nepotism and “selective justice” in the handling of Nnamdi Kanu’s case in a statement that was made available to AF24NEWS on Friday.
The IPOB lawyer criticized the FG for keeping Kanu in custody despite the Appeal Court’s order to release him, while criminals and terrorists with blood on their hands are free to roam the nation.
He said, “The specific and disproportionate ‘equity’ framework in Nigeria is so glaring so that even the visually impaired might be able to see.
“I just watched a video of a non-state actor named Asari Dokubo escorting a group of men carrying a variety of guns and ammunition.Consider for a moment what would have transpired in the Southeast of Nigeria if this had occurred;or if this was carried out by someone associated in any way with Onyendu Mazi Nnamdi Kanu or the Indigenous People of Biafra.

“Same DSS is still incarcerating my innocent domestic staff who were abducted on June 6, 2021, during the bloody invasion of my ancestral home;and whose unconditional release the Court has ordered.
‘While Mazi Nnamdi Kanu has been languishing in solitary confinement in the DSS custody for more than 17 months for merely exercising his fundamental rights to self-determination, which are guaranteed by the existing Nigerian Constitution and other international laws, treaties, and conventions, Bello Turji Kachalla, more commonly referred to as Turji, is walking around free.
“They might play the ostrich all they need, however the obvious truth is that there is a different “equity” framework, explicitly cut out for individuals from the south-eastern piece of Nigeria.We will challenge this in court as a form of discrimination that the amended 1999 Constitution explicitly prohibits.
According to the Appeal Court’s ruling, the Federal Government of Nigeria must immediately release Mazi Nnamdi Kanu.The time is now, too!
“While innocent Biafrans who are genuinely exercising their constitutionally guaranteed rights to self-determination are being ferociously hunted down, killed, and/or dumped in various detention facilities in Nigeria without being tried, the Federal Government of Nigeria should desist from romancing with real terrorists.
“The Federal Government of Nigeria must end selective justice, pursue the genuine terrorists, and release Mazi Nnamdi Kanu in accordance with the Appeal Court’s order.”
